Commit Graph

15630 Commits

Author SHA1 Message Date
Benoit Marty 4889295361 Tentative fix for rageshake 37765 2022-05-04 10:07:08 +02:00
Benoit Marty 97702317dd Rename var 2022-05-04 10:07:08 +02:00
Benoit Marty 29dc114d1a Format the file 2022-05-04 10:07:08 +02:00
Benoit Marty 1e3ad30422
Merge pull request #5920 from vector-im/dependabot/gradle/org.jlleitschuh.gradle.ktlint-10.3.0
Bump org.jlleitschuh.gradle.ktlint from 10.2.1 to 10.3.0
2022-05-04 09:31:57 +02:00
Maxime NATUREL 63119ca2a3
Merge pull request #5912 from vector-im/fix/mna/issue-5855-response-state-event
[SDK] Add missing return type in RoomApi.sendStateEvent()
2022-05-04 09:25:49 +02:00
dependabot[bot] f771a22161
Bump org.jlleitschuh.gradle.ktlint from 10.2.1 to 10.3.0
Bumps org.jlleitschuh.gradle.ktlint from 10.2.1 to 10.3.0.

---
updated-dependencies:
- dependency-name: org.jlleitschuh.gradle.ktlint
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
2022-05-03 23:06:53 +00:00
anoloth 00cc8decdb Translated using Weblate (Lao)
Currently translated at 100.0% (57 of 57 strings)

Translation: Element Android/Element Android Store
Translate-URL: https://translate.element.io/projects/element-android/element-store/lo/
2022-05-03 23:00:31 +00:00
anoloth 5ea4c0f8c9 Translated using Weblate (Lao)
Currently translated at 59.0% (1309 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/lo/
2022-05-03 23:00:29 +00:00
chanthajohn keoviengkhone c444a0bf67 Translated using Weblate (Lao)
Currently translated at 59.0% (1309 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/lo/
2022-05-03 23:00:29 +00:00
John Doe 3e9636e0d3 Translated using Weblate (Spanish)
Currently translated at 64.9% (37 of 57 strings)

Translation: Element Android/Element Android Store
Translate-URL: https://translate.element.io/projects/element-android/element-store/es/
2022-05-03 22:59:46 +00:00
alejandro a96e8455e8 Translated using Weblate (Spanish)
Currently translated at 99.7% (2211 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/es/
2022-05-03 22:59:45 +00:00
Russell Davies bc51ff051e Translated using Weblate (Spanish)
Currently translated at 99.7% (2211 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/es/
2022-05-03 22:59:45 +00:00
John Doe 6a2507e477 Translated using Weblate (Spanish)
Currently translated at 99.7% (2211 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/es/
2022-05-03 22:59:45 +00:00
Benoit Marty 8602cbba7a Fix test 2022-05-03 17:43:00 +02:00
fedrunov 9f520d4e8a
track room open and room join analytics events (#5696) 2022-05-03 16:11:40 +02:00
Maxime NATUREL 3b022eee83 Adding return type description in doc of StateService 2022-05-03 15:20:06 +02:00
Maxime NATUREL e5bb7ae5cd Return the created eventId in methods to send state events 2022-05-03 15:06:04 +02:00
Benoit Marty 2f0e4e4f3d changelog 2022-05-03 15:02:34 +02:00
Benoit Marty cdcaf93fc7 Fix F-Droid build 2022-05-03 15:02:34 +02:00
Benoit Marty 32bc93c87d Ensure the `Clock` interface is used. 2022-05-03 15:02:34 +02:00
Benoit Marty 40d3203297 Use Clock interface app side 2022-05-03 15:02:34 +02:00
Benoit Marty 45526c0e3a Use Clock (SDK API change) 2022-05-03 15:02:34 +02:00
Benoit Marty 6a61e639e0 SDK: Replace usage of `System.currentTimeMillis()` by a `Clock` interface (#4562)
Sometimes move to UUID or Random numbers instead.
2022-05-03 15:02:34 +02:00
Benoit Marty 40e26900b0 Create a Clock SDK side (#4562) 2022-05-03 15:02:34 +02:00
Benoit Marty 8dd87321da
Merge pull request #5866 from vector-im/feature/bma/fix_sanity_test
Fix sanity test
2022-05-03 15:02:04 +02:00
Maxime NATUREL d79a9c5b8b Adding changelog entry 2022-05-03 14:31:01 +02:00
Adam Brown c09a93c171 fixes crash when accepting calls
- the event insert logic is designed to be single threaded however the scope will allow coroutine continuation which leads to unintended multiple thread access for processing and post processing
- the fix is to convert the launching to a flow which will sequentially process the launch logic on the single threaded scope
2022-05-03 12:26:13 +01:00
Adam Brown 0325754d12
Merge pull request #5884 from vector-im/sync-analytics-plan
Sync analytics plan
2022-05-03 09:18:29 +01:00
anoloth 38e652de8d Translated using Weblate (Lao)
Currently translated at 26.9% (597 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/lo/
2022-05-02 15:53:23 +00:00
chanthajohn keoviengkhone 837f49cebf Translated using Weblate (Lao)
Currently translated at 26.9% (597 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/lo/
2022-05-02 15:53:22 +00:00
Valere 2da109cb74
Merge pull request #5886 from vector-im/feature/bca/fix_graceperiod_autorageshake
Fix UISIDetector grace period bug
2022-05-02 17:50:55 +02:00
Valere f57e20c73c make grace period configurable and reduce test duration 2022-05-02 17:19:08 +02:00
Benoit Marty e36c57ff29 changelog 2022-05-02 15:07:35 +02:00
Maxime NATUREL a971b19f5c Removing location info from log 2022-05-02 15:06:13 +02:00
Benoit Marty 672023e94b This is not necessary to map the EventId, it does not bring any new information. 2022-05-02 15:01:02 +02:00
Maxime NATUREL 1720dc1fac Removing non necessary fields when mapping from DB model 2022-05-02 14:23:24 +02:00
Maxime NATUREL 3201308125 Renaming other timestamps with shorter names 2022-05-02 14:05:05 +02:00
Maxime NATUREL 11ebab094b Fixing aggregation and adding debug logs 2022-05-02 12:24:30 +02:00
Maxime NATUREL 0f415a56dd Using .wip extension for changelog entry 2022-05-02 12:20:17 +02:00
Maxime NATUREL 0fc2352c07 Adding docs to describe message contents 2022-05-02 11:21:41 +02:00
Maxime NATUREL a27569770b Renaming timestamp fields 2022-05-02 11:10:36 +02:00
Valere d0bff5000c Fix UISIDetector grace period bug 2022-05-02 10:10:29 +02:00
chagai95 ac7dd2cef3
Create 5885.bugfix 2022-05-02 09:13:46 +02:00
chagai95 5f1aad76e6
don't pause timer when call is held
This is also the way it is implemented in web and the correct way
2022-05-02 09:11:47 +02:00
anoloth 99765bbcfd Added translation using Weblate (Lao) 2022-05-02 06:14:27 +00:00
bmarty cd6807d9b2 Sync analytics plan 2022-05-02 00:03:56 +00:00
John Doe 5fecb1cb97 Translated using Weblate (Spanish)
Currently translated at 95.2% (2111 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/es/
2022-05-01 21:10:37 +00:00
Kominak Halalu 6e984ef68b Translated using Weblate (Bengali)
Currently translated at 0.1% (1 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/bn/
2022-04-30 14:59:41 +00:00
huangguiniab 9e4278a893 Translated using Weblate (Chinese (Simplified))
Currently translated at 93.2% (2068 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/zh_Hans/
2022-04-30 14:59:41 +00:00
Johan Smits aa3c1bdefd Translated using Weblate (Dutch)
Currently translated at 100.0% (2217 of 2217 strings)

Translation: Element Android/Element Android App
Translate-URL: https://translate.element.io/projects/element-android/element-app/nl/
2022-04-30 14:59:41 +00:00